Radio Shack doesn't actually manufacture parts. They just buy them from the
same Taiwanese suppliers as everyone else. Depending on what it is, you may
get the exact same part from Mouser or Digikey. Of course, you will pay a
lot more for it at Radio Shack.

Their prototyping boards are really handy.
